WEST MANOR HOUSE - Whalton - List Entry

  • Description

    "House, dated 1729 with initials I:R on lintel, possibly incorporating earlier fabric. Alterations 1908-9 by Sir Edwin Lutyens for Mrs. Eustace Smith, when the house was incorporated in the Manor House (q.v.); it is now a separate tenancy. Squared stone (except for rubble in ground floor left return), cut dressings; stone slate roof. 2 storeys, 5 bays, symmetrical, chamfered plinth. Central 6-panel door with overlight in wave-moulded raised stone surround with shaped lintel top; 12-pane sash windows with raised lintels and stepped keystones...."
